Project Title :Construction Of Elevated Road Connecting To Railway Station In Maharashtra.
Company Name : Thane Municipal Corporation
Project Detail :Cabinet Minister of Urban Development and Public Works Eknath Shinde has set a 15-month deadline for completion of Satis-2 project to considerably ease traffic congestion around Thane railway station on the eastern side

The announcement was made during the ground breaking ceremony of the project on 19 February 2022. The project is being jointly executed by the Thane Municipal Corporation and Thane Smart City authorities

Once completed, the project will be the first and longest-ever elevated road connecting a railway station in Mumbai Metropolitan Region (MMR)

The nearly 2.4-km long, uni-directional road will be used only for public transport buses. It will start from Eastern Express Highway in Thane west to connect with the multi-tier deck on the east at Thane railway station before turning around to land on the opposite lane of the EEH

The 8,000 sq mtr deck outside the railway station will have multiple tiers with the basement reserved for parking of 325 vehicles while the second level will have ticket windows

The next deck will have restrooms and waiting halls for passengers while the uppermost deck will have access to the bus station and the railway platforms
